Vital Metals's Accounts Payable for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2025 was A$1.30 Mil.

Vital Metals's quarterly Accounts Payable declined from Dec. 2024 (A$0.41 Mil) to Jun. 2025 (A$0.16 Mil) but then increased from Jun. 2025 (A$0.16 Mil) to Dec. 2025 (A$1.30 Mil).

Vital Metals's annual Accounts Payable declined from Jun. 2023 (A$1.05 Mil) to Jun. 2024 (A$0.42 Mil) and declined from Jun. 2024 (A$0.42 Mil) to Jun. 2025 (A$0.16 Mil).

Vital Metals Business Description

Other Exchanges VTMXF:USAVJF:Germany
Address 56 Pitt Street, Level 5, Sydney, NSW, AUS, 2000
Vital Metals Ltd is a mineral exploration company focusing on rare earth, technology metals, and gold projects. The company has one geographical segment, Canada. Its projects include the Nechalacho Project in Canada.
